            The current proposal is for the underground road link to join from Victoria Road next to the Iron Cove Bridge to the Rozelle Rail yards.

            At this stage, the State Government is still carrying out geotechnical investigations to help develop the early designs for the project.

            “The M4-M5 link is being designed to reduce congestion in and around the City West Link, Anzac Bridge and Victoria Road. We believe the extension would assist this cause,” Deputy Mayor McCaffrey said.

            The M4-M5 link is the final stage of the WestConnex project and will link the extended M4 Motorway at Haberfield to the new M5 Motorway in St Peters. The project is due to open to the community in 2023.
